RAMBAN, Aug 19: The Indian Army successfully concluded a Photography Cadre under Operation Sadbhavana at Banihal, aimed at promoting skill development, creativity and technical proficiency among local youth. A total of 23 participants, including students and civil teachers, successfully completed the training programme.
The cadre provided participants with a blend of theoretical instruction and extensive practical training in various aspects of photography. The training covered camera handling, exposure, composition, framing, lighting, focusing techniques and visual storytelling, enabling participants to develop both technical knowledge and creative skills.
